Metavante First-Hand: Feedback from Marquette IT Graduates


Why were you interested in employment at Metavante?
ITSO sponsored a "Java and Jobs" event where students were able to talk to recruiters from different companies; Metavante was one of several companies to attend, but was the only one that stood out as a corporation that I could really see myself working for. I applied the same day. - Robert

How has the LPA training program influenced your transition from college to the work force?
The program was a good way to get familiar with the company as a whole before starting in my position. The transition didn't feel overwhelming because learning about the company and culture was separate from learning the actual job. - Jason

As a recent graduate settling into a new job, what piece of advice would you offer students beginning their job search?
My advice would be to embrace the change you are about to go through. It is alright to be a little scared of the unknown, but strive to get all that you can out of the experiences you are about to have. - Matthew

Always keep your options open, you never know what will fall into your lap. - Sasha
